Proposed change

Since the last firmware update of the devolo Magic LAN devices the properties dict from the zeroconf service info can be empty. I assume it is a firmware issue, but I couldn't convince devolo, yet. Nevertheless I can handle that case to avoid exceptions in the users log. In my tests the devices could still be properly discovered and added.
